Speedrunning can apparently be split into two different categories.

- People rushing the enemies rather then attempting to cover.

or

- People speeding for the mission goal rather then killing enemies or looting anything.

The first doesn't bother me too much, Warframe is just that kind of game. If the group is doing harder levels, things may well live long enough and be dangerous enough to allow someone to stand back and snipe, but if you're running through lower areas or if any of the group is just too strong, then you probably won't get to kill much.

The second one does grate on me though. There's a chance for resources everywhere, and enemies can also drop them or mods, so I hate passing everything by. I know that on boss stages, some are just out to repeatedly farm the boss as quickly as possible... and I look forward to improved grouping/matchmaking options for that very reason. Even if I'm farming the boss for a blueprint, I still want to play the game by actually engaging in combat, and maybe even searching the stages.

To each their own, or that would be true at least if we didn't just all get thrown together so randomly :)
